PROBATE & ESTATES PLANNING
Probate and estate planning law in Jamaica involves the legal processes for managing and distributing a person’s estate after their death. Estate planning ensures that an individual’s assets are allocated according to their wishes, typically through the creation of wills, trusts, and other legal documents. Probate is the court-supervised procedure that validates these documents, settles debts, and distributes the remaining assets to beneficiaries. These laws are designed to provide clarity, reduce conflicts among heirs, and ensure a smooth transfer of property and assets.
